Complete Filmography & Success Status
Tracking the career evolution and box office verdicts of Bob Graham.
| Year | Movie | Character | Success | More |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1953 | The I Don't Care Girl | Larry Woods | Hit | Similar → |
| 1946 | People Are Funny | Luke | Flop | Similar → |
| 1945 | The Little Witch | Pedro Castillo, Band Leader | Flop | Similar → |
| 1945 | Week-End at the Waldorf | Singer | Average | Similar → |
